" Beginning PHP and MySQL: From Novice to Professional " is widely regarded as an authoritative and comprehensive "bible" for web development . Reviewers frequently praise it as a high-value reference guide that effectively bridges the gap between basic tutorials and real-world application.

: Many readers find it more useful as a modular reference guide than a step-by-step tutorial.

: The 5th Edition is updated for PHP 7 and covers modern practices like Object-Oriented Programming (OOP), session management, and security. Pros and Cons Beginning PHP and MySQL: From Novice to Professional

: It contains over 500 code examples for real-world tasks like auto-login features, file uploads, and sending HTML emails.

: The book is described as "three books in one," providing thorough introductions to PHP, MySQL, and the integration of both.
